ATSI seeks a Contract Manager for Global Peace Operations Initiative in TOGO. The Contractor shall provide contract management through a dedicated Project Manager (PM) possessing the background and skills to effectively serve as the principal point of contact for contract performance issues and communications between the COR, CO, and Program Office.
*This position is contingent on contract award.
Key responsibilities include:
- The Contractor shall manage all personnel performing work on the SOW, including those CONUS personnel conducting contract management and those personnel working on each required OCONUS task, including all key personnel and all non-key personnel requiring COR review and approval.
- The Contractor shall conduct all routine management and supervision required to successfully achieve all performance and quality assurance objectives of the SOW.
- The Contractor shall submit a weekly report to the COR and Program Office. The report shall include a summary of ongoing activities, a list of all contract staff actively performing on each task and shall highlight any event or technical issue that jeopardizes contract performance.
Education and Experience include:
Minimum of 10 years’ experience conducting foreign security force capacity building at the tactical or operational level and below.
· Bachelor’s degree from an accredited institution.
· Secret-level security clearance or above.
· Minimum five years of increasing responsibility as a program or project manager or a team leader in the field of security force capacity building or in a directly related area.
· Relevant military operations of foreign security force capacity building experience or program management experience in the last five years.
